Marchrawnen y dŵr

Etymology

edit

marchrawn (horsetails) + dŵr (water).

Noun

edit

marchrawn y dŵr f (collective, singulative marchrawnen y dŵr)[1]

  1. water horsetails (Equisetum fluviatile)[1]
